Frequently Asked Questions about Santa Fe Springs

How much are Studio apartments in Santa Fe Springs?

There are currently 90 Studio Apartments in Santa Fe Springs with rent ranges from $1,250 to $3,651 with an average price of $1,820.

What is the current price range for One Bedroom Santa Fe Springs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Santa Fe Springs ranges from $1,600 to $3,990 with an average monthly rent of $2,319.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Santa Fe Springs c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Santa Fe Springs range from $2,050 to $5,640.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,922.

How expensive are Santa Fe Springs Three Bedroom Apartments?

There are currently 167 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Santa Fe Springs on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,950 to $7,024 - averaging $3,721 for the location.
